bookrecsbyjess's current reads
2 books

561 pages first pub 2016 (editions)

fiction fantasy lgbtqia+ young adult adventurous dark emotional medium-paced

9 hours, 37 minutes first pub 2024 (editions) user-added

fiction historical romance medium-paced